Use a cover not to damage the vehicle surface.
Disconnect connectors carefully not to be damaged.
Mark wires or hoses for identification not to be confused.
Disconnect the negative terminal(B) from the battery(A).
Remove the engine cover(A).
Remove the intake air hose(D) and the air cleaner assembly(A).
Disconnect the AFS connector(B).
Disconnect the breather hose(C) from air cleaner hose(D).
Disconnect the PCM connectors. (See FL group)
Remove the intake air hose(D) and air cleaner (A).
After disconnecting the positive terminal from the battery, remove the battery.
Remove the transaxle oil cooler hoses(A).
Remove engine wiring.
Disconnect the RH rear oxygen sensor connector(A).
Disconnect the LH rear oxygen sensor connector(A) and the CPS connector(B).
Disconnect the transaxle wire harness connector and remove transaxle control cable.
Remove the wiring brackets(A).
After removing a transaxle bracket, remove the inhibiter switch connector(A) and shift cable(B).
Remove the solenoid valve connector(A).
Remove the input speed sensor, output speed sensor(A, B) and vehicle speed sensor connector(C).
Disconnect the ground wire(A).
Disconnect the power steering pressure sensor connector(A).
Remove the power steering hose mounting bolts(A-2EA).
Remove the front wheels.
Disconnect the EPS connector(A) around the left hand side front wheel.
Remove the transaxle mounting bolts(B, C).
Using the SST(09200-38001), hold the enigne and transaxle assembly safely.
Remove the transaxle insulator mounting bolt(A).
After lifting up the vehicle, remove the under cover(A).
Drain transaxle oil.
Disconnect the power steering pump hose(A).
Disconnect the lower arm assembly from the knuckle. (see DS group)
Disconnect the tie rod end ball joint from the knuckle after removing the split pin. (see DS group)
Disconnect the stabilizer bar link. (see SS group)
Remove the front roll stopper mounting bolt. (see ST group)
Remove the front exhaust pipe. (see EM group)
Remove the rear roll stopper mounting bolt. (see ST group)
Using the SST(09624-38000) and holding the cross member(A) with a jack, remvoe the steering bolt.
Remove the cross member.
Remove drive shaft from transaxle. (See 'DS' group)
Install a jack for supporting the transaxle assembly.
Remove the transaxle under mounting bolts(A) and the drive plate bolts(B).
Lifting the vehicle up and lowering the jack slowly, remove the transaxle assembly.
Installation is in the reverse order of removal.
Perform the following :
Adjust the shift cable.
Refill the transaxle with fluid.
Refill the radiator with engine coolant.
Bleed air from the cooling system with the heater valve open.
Clean the battery posts and cable terminals with sandpaper, assemble them, and apply grease to prevent corrosion.
Lowering the vehicle or lifting up a jack, install the transaxle assembly.
Tighten the transaxle under mounting bolts(A, B).
TORQUE:
34.3~41.2 Nm(350~420 Kgf.cm, 25.3~30.4 lb.ft) - A
45.1~52.0 Nm(460~530 Kgf.cm, 33.3~38.3 lb.ft) - B
After removing a jack, insert the drive shafts. (see DS group)
Supporting the cross member with the SST(09624-38000), tighten the steering column bolt and the cross member mounting bolts. (see ST group)
Tighten the rear roll stopper mounting bolt. (see ST group)
TORQUE:
49.0~63.7 Nm(500~650 Kgf.cm, 36.2~47.0 lb.ft)
Install the front exhaust pipe. (see EM group)
Tighten the front roll stopper mounting bolt. (see ST group)
TORQUE:
49.0~63.7 Nm(500~650 Kgf.cm, 36.2~47.0 lb.ft)
Install the steering bar tie rod, the stabilizer bar link and the lower arm assembly. (see ST group)
Clamp the power steering pump hose(A).
Install the under cover(A).
After lowering the vehicle, tighten the transaxle insulator mounting bolt(A).
TORQUE:
63.7~83.4 Nm(650~850 Kgf.cm, 47.0~61.5 lb.ft)
Tighten the transaxle mounting bolts(B, C).
TORQUE:
32.4~49.0 Nm(350~420 Kgf.cm, 23.9~36.2 lb.ft) - A
63.7~83.4 Nm(650~850 Kgf.cm, 47.0~61.5 lb.ft) - B
Remove the SST(09200-38001) holding the engine and transaxle assembly.
Connect the EPS connector(A) and install the front wheels and tires.
Install the power steering hose mounting bolts(A-2EA).
Connect the power steering pressure sensor connector(A).
Connect the transaxle wire harness connector and the control cable.
Install the wiring brackets(A).
Connect the inhibitor switch connector(A) and the shift cable(B) and install the transaxle bracket.
Connect the solenoid valve connector(A).
Connect the input/output speed sensor connectors(A, B) and vehicle speed sensor connector(C).
Connect the ground wire(A).
Connect engine wiring.
Connect the RH rear oxygen sensor connector(A).
Connect the LH rear oxygen sensor connector(A) and the CPS connector(B).
Clamp the transaxle oil cooler hoses(A).
After disconnecting the positive terminal from the battery, remove the battery.
Install the intake air hose(D) and the air cleaner assembly(A).
Connect the AFS connector(B).
Clamp the breather hose(C) from the air cleaner hose(D).
Connect the PCM connectors. (See FL group)
Install the intake air hose(D) and the air cleaner assembly(A).
Install the engine cover(A).
Connect the negative terminal(B) from the battery(A).
